Set Attendance Location
The Set Attendance Location feature allows Admin to configure their attendance location settings, including specifying attendance types, selecting location coordinates, setting shift times and enabling face recognition.
List of Set Attendance Location Features
1. Set Attendance Location Type
Admin can define the type of attendance location, which determines how and where attendance is recorded:
- General Designated Location: A fixed attendance location applicable to all Admin.
- Group Designated Location: A fixed attendance location assigned to a specific group.
- Group Roaming Location: A flexible location for a group, allowing movement within an area.
- Individual Designated Location: A fixed attendance location assigned to an individual user.
- Individual Roaming Location: A flexible location assigned to an individual user, allowing movement.
2. Set Attendance Location Assignee(s)
Depending on the selected attendance type, Admin must assign users to the location:
-
For Group Locations (Group Designated / Group Roaming):
- Admin can select multiple users as assignees.
- Users assigned to the group location must adhere to the defined location settings.
-
For Individual Locations (Individual Designated / Individual Roaming):
- Admin should assign only one user.
- If a single user is to be assigned, it is recommended to use the Individual type.
3. Set Attendance Location Place Name
- Specify the name of the location where attendance will be recorded (e.g., Main Office).
4. Specify Attendance Location (Non-Roaming Locations Only)
For non-roaming locations, Admin must define the exact location where attendance should be recorded. This can be done using one of the following methods:
- Search via Map UI: Use the integrated map interface to search and select the desired location.
- Manual Input: Enter the Longitude and Latitude coordinates of the attendance location.
5. Radius Tolerance
- Define the radius tolerance (e.g., 5 meters), specifying how far a user can be from the designated location while still being able to record attendance.
6. Assigned Shift
Admin must specify the assigned working hours for attendance tracking:
- Start Time: The time attendance begins.
- Finish Time: The time attendance ends.
7. Face Recognition AI
Admin can enable or disable Face Recognition AI for attendance verification:
- Enabled: Requires facial recognition for attendance submission.
- Disabled: Allows attendance submission without facial recognition.
